6  RESERVATION OF TITLE

a The Company shall retain title to the Goods until it has received payment in full of all sums due in connection with the supply of the Goods to the Customer or in connection with any other transaction.  For these purposes, the Company has only received a payment when the amount of that payment is irrevocably credited to its bank account. 

 

b If any of the Goods owned by the Company is attached to or incorporated into other goods not owned by the Company and is not identifiable or separable from the resulting composite or mixed goods, title to the resulting composite or mixed goods shall vest in the Company and be retained by the Company for as long as and on the same terms as those on which it would have retained title to the Goods in question. 

 

c If the Customer fails to make payment to the Company when due, enters into bankruptcy, liquidation or a composition with its creditors, has a receiver, manager or administrator appointed over all or part of its assets, or becomes insolvent, or if the Company has reasonable cause to believe that any of these events is likely to occur, the Company shall have the right without prejudice to any other remedies: 

 

i To enter without prior notice to any premises where the Goods owned by it may be, and to repossess and dispose of any such Goods owned by it to discharge any sums owed to it by the Customer. 

 

ii To require the Customer not to re-sell or part with possession of the Goods owned by it until the Customer has paid in full all sums owed by it to the Company. 

 

d The Goods shall once the risk has passed to the Customer under Clause 4 c or otherwise be and remain at the Customer's risk at all times unless and until the Company has retaken possession of such Goods. 

 

7  WARRANTY

a The Company warrants to the Customer that the Goods will be free from defects in materials and workmanship for a period of twelve months from the date of delivery to the Customer (the "warranty period"). Provided the Customer makes a full inspection of the Goods immediately upon receipt and thereafter gives the Company written notice containing full particulars of any defects it discovers and the circumstances in which such defects occurred, the Company shall, at its sole option, either repair, replace or give credit for price of any such Goods which its examination confirms are defective in material or in workmanship within the warranty period provided that the Customer has adhered to the payment provisions herein and further provided that:

 

i The Customer returns the defective Goods to the Company or its authorised service depot (as directed by the Company) and pays all transportation charges, duties and taxes associated with the repair, replacement and return of the Goods to the Customer, or: 

 

ii If at the Company's option, the Company arranges for a technician to visit the Customer's location to repair or replace the defective Goods, the Customer pays all transportation charges for the technician and his equipment, including any applicable duties and taxes, accommodation and living expenses and normal charges for the technician's time while travelling and for delays beyond the Company's control (save that the Customer shall not be liable for any charge in respect of the technician's time on site engaged in carrying out the repair or replacement of such defective Goods). 

 

iii The repair or replacement of defective Goods during the warranty period under clause 7 shall not extend the period of the warranty of such Goods. 

 

iv  The provisions of clause 7 .a  do not extend to any Goods which have been subjected to misuse, accident or improper installation, maintenance, application or operation nor do they extend to Goods which have been repaired or altered other than by the agents or employees of the Company unless previously authorised in writing by the Company. 

 

v The warranty contained in clause 7 is expressly accepted by the Customer in place of all other terms, warranties conditions or liabilities whether express or implied, in fact, or law, relating to the state, quality description, capacity, design, construction, operation, use or performance of the Goods or to the merchantability, repair, or fitness for a particular purpose of the Goods or otherwise. No agreement varying or extending the same will be binding upon the Company unless in writing signed by the proprietor of the Company. 

 

vi  Unless the proprietor of the Company otherwise expressly agrees in writing, in no circumstances will the Company's liability to the Customer for any breach of the warranty contained in clause 7 exceed the price paid for the products concerning any claim made.
